How many satellites still work?
16,351 objects carry a source-backed status that says they still function.

The headline adds the statuses that assert a working object. Decayed, non-operational and unknown rows are listed here but are not counted in it.
What this number is not
- This is the single easiest number in the field to get wrong. The main launch catalog’s status field is a phase code: its value "O" means "still in orbit", not "operational". Reading it as operational once marked 15,697 of these objects as working spacecraft.
- Where no source states a status, this catalog says unknown rather than guessing, and those objects are not in this figure. It is a floor, not a total.
- A stated status is only as fresh as the source that stated it. A satellite that quietly stopped working can still be published as operational for a long time afterwards.
How it is computed, and how it is checked
Objects whose operational status came from a source that publishes it, rather than being inferred from the fact that they are still up there, counted where that status asserts a functioning object: operational, partially operational, extended mission, standby and in-orbit spare.
The grouping runs here, in one pass over every matching row, so there is no second route to this figure that a page render can afford. What is checked is that the read was complete: Postgres counts the matching rows itself, and that is compared against the number of rows actually read. A truncated or capped read withholds the figure. The headline is not independently recomputed, and the page does not claim it is.
Read check today: Postgres counts 16,564 matching rows, and 16,564 were read and grouped here, so nothing was dropped or truncated. The headline itself is not recomputed by a second route.
